On August 18, 2025 Anocca AB (‘Anocca’ or the ‘Company’), a leading clinical-stage T-cell immunotherapy company, reported the company has successfully raised SEK ~440 million (USD ~46 million) in financing (Press release, Anocca, AUG 18, 2025, View Source [SID1234655340]). The additional capital will be used to drive the continued progress of VIDAR-1, Anocca’s gene-edited TCR-T cell therapies targeting mutant KRAS in pancreatic cancer, through early-stage clinical development, as well as progress Anocca’s preclinical pipeline. The financing was led by Mellby Gård with strong support from AMF, Ramsbury and existing shareholders, alongside new investors.

Recruitment is now open for Phase I of the multi-centre trial of VIDAR-1, which is being conducted at leading university hospitals across Sweden, Denmark, Germany and The Netherlands.
Reagan Jarvis, co-founder and Chief Executive Officer of Anocca, said: "We thank our investors for their strong and continued support as we advance our first TCR-T cell therapy products into the clinic. The team has built a unique discovery platform and in-house manufacturing capability, and we are now excited to see the first products reaching patients with high unmet need."
Johan Andersson, Chairman of Mellby Gård, commented: "We have been invested in Anocca throughout its preclinical development and are pleased to see the Company transition into a clinical stage biotech. We look forward to seeing Anocca help patients that have limited treatment options today with their innovative approach to T-cell therapies".
SEB Corporate Finance acted as financial advisor to Anocca on the finalisation of the transaction, and Mannheimer Swartling and HWF Advokater have acted as legal advisors.
